About this map

Soldier Key and the northern reaches of Sands Key anchor this mid-century maritime study of the transition from Biscayne Bay to the open Atlantic Ocean. The map documents a landscape defined by water and shoals, tracing the delicate chain of the Ragged Keys and the submerged hazards of Black Ledge and Featherbed Bank. A lone Lookout Tower stands on the southernmost of the Ragged Keys, providing a rare terrestrial waypoint in a region dominated by navigational aids like the Intracoastal Waterway and various daybeacons.
